雲伺服器自建mysql資料庫存儲空間,怎麼建立雲資料庫

本文目錄一覽:

mysql資料庫存儲空間與數據大小不一致

阿里雲RDS伺服器報硬碟磁碟空間不足(100G的磁碟空間),登錄後台查看,使用了130G,使用 SELECT file_name, concat(TOTAL_EXTENTS,’M’) as ‘FIle_size’ FROM INFORMATION_SCHEMA.FILES order by TOTAL_EXTENTS DESC 查看,只使用了60G左右。那麼還有70G是怎麼用了呢?

查看問題:

查詢 information_schema.innodb_trx ,看是哪些語句導致的。

原因:

ibdata文件很大,MySQL實例可能會 由於長時間不結束的查詢導致 ibdata1 文件過大且無法收縮,導致實例空間滿 ,為避免數據丟失,RDS會對實例進行自動鎖定,磁碟鎖定之後,將無法進行寫入操作

解決方案:

重啟實例即可

雲伺服器上的mysql空間是幹什麼的

這個空間主要是用來存儲數據的,你買的大小就是決定了你的資料庫可以儲存多少數據,當然一般雲資料庫都是支持擴容的。

雲伺服器怎麼裝mysql資料庫

據了解,小鳥雲默認不安裝MySQL

安裝的話可以使用

yum -y install mysql mysql-server mysql-devel

安裝基本MySQL資料庫伺服器

默認安裝在 /usr/local/mysql

數據存放 /var/lib/mysql

配置文件 /etc/my.cnf

默認安裝的版本版本為:MySQL 5.1

小鳥雲創業者專用雲主機上線(僅售¥990元/年,原價:¥3372元/年)

配置:2核CPU+2G內存+5M帶寬+100GSSD磁碟+20G防禦

性能:IntelHaswell + DDR4 + SSD = 50,000IOPS、800Mb/s吞吐量

mysql資料庫的存放位置在哪裡

資料庫文件默認存放位置:C:\ProgramFiles\MySQL\MySQLServer5.0\data。

資料庫的配置文件在C:\ProgramFiles\MySQL\MySQLServer5.0\my.ini。

在data文件夾里找到不test的資料庫文件夾和自己創建的文件夾是因為test資料庫是空的資料庫,用於測試使用,自己的文件夾需要去mysql資料庫尋找。

mysql資料庫文件默認存放位置:C:\ProgramFiles\MySQL\MySQLServer5.0\mysql。

MySQL是一種開放源代碼的關係型資料庫管理系統(RDBMS),MySQL資料庫系統使用最常用的資料庫管理語言–結構化查詢語言(SQL)進行資料庫管理。

下面詳細介紹幾個找不同資料庫用到的命令:

1、選擇你所創建的資料庫

mysqlUSEMYSQLDATA;(按回車鍵出現Databasechanged時說明操作成功!)

2、:使用SHOW語句找出在伺服器上當前存在什麼資料庫

mysqlSHOWDATABASES;

3、查看現在的資料庫中存在什麼表

mysqlSHOWTABLES;

4、顯示錶的結構。

mysqlDESCRIBEMYTABLE;

擴展資料:

mysql資料庫伺服器有三個資料庫:information_schema資料庫,mysql資料庫,test資料庫。

1、nformation_schema資料庫:這個資料庫保存了mysql伺服器所有資料庫的信息。比如資料庫的名、資料庫的表、訪問許可權、資料庫表的數據類型,資料庫索引的信息等等。就是關於這個資料庫的點點滴滴信息都存儲在這個資料庫中。

nformation_schema資料庫是MySQL自帶的,它提供了訪問資料庫元數據的方式。什麼是元數據呢?元數據是關於數據的數據,如資料庫名或表名,列的數據類型,或訪問許可權等。有些時候用於表述該信息的其他術語包括「數據詞典」和「系統目錄」。

在MySQL中,把information_schema看作是一個資料庫,確切說是信息資料庫。其中保存著關於MySQL伺服器所維護的所有其他資料庫的信息。

如資料庫名,資料庫的表,表欄的數據類型與訪問許可權等。在INFORMATION_SCHEMA中,有數個只讀表。它們實際上是視圖,而不是基本表,因此,將無法看到與之相關的任何文件。

2、mysql資料庫:這個資料庫中是mysql資料庫中的所有的信息表。

這個是mysql的核心資料庫,類似於sqlserver中的master表,主要負責存儲資料庫的用戶、許可權設置、關鍵字等mysql自己需要使用的控制和管理信息。不可以刪除,如果對mysql不是很了解,也不要輕易修改這個資料庫裡面的表信息。

3、test資料庫:空的資料庫,用於測試用。

這個是安裝時候創建的一個測試資料庫,和它的名字一樣,是一個完全的空資料庫,沒有任何錶,可以刪除。

參考資料:百度百科-MySQL資料庫

參考資料:百度百科-mySQL

參考資料:百度百科-test

雲資料庫有必要嗎?雲資料庫RDS和在雲伺服器上自建MySQL有什麼區別?

RDS是阿里雲提供的即開即用的關係型資料庫服務,兼容了MySQL和SQL Server兩種資料庫引擎。在傳統資料庫的基礎上,阿里雲RDS提供了強大豐富的功能從而保證了高可用性、高安全性以及高性能。此外,RDS還提供了諸多便利功能提升了RDS的易用性。

★高可用:

採用主從熱備的架構。主機down機或者出現故障後,備機秒級完成無縫切換,服務可用性承諾:99.95%

提供自動多重備份的機制。用戶可以自行選擇備份周期,也可以根據自身業務特點隨時進行臨時備份,數據可靠性承諾:99.9999%

數據回溯到任意時間點。用戶可以選擇7天內的任意時間點創建一個臨時實例,臨時實例生成後驗證數據無誤,即可將數據遷移到RDS實例,從而完成數據回溯操作。

★高安全

提供白名單訪問策略。可自行設置允許訪問的IP及IP段,有效防止黑客掃描埠進行伺服器攻擊。

提供閾值報警的功能。支持實例鎖定報警、連接數報警、IOPS報警、磁碟空間使用報警、CPU報警等。

提供SQL注入告警。將對發往RDS的疑似SQL注入的語句進行記錄並展示,供用戶進行程序調整,杜絕SQL注入的發生。

SQL審計。記錄所有發往RDS的SQL語句,系統將記錄SQL語句相關的連接IP、訪問資料庫的名稱、執行語句的賬號、執行時間、返回記錄數等信息。供用戶對RDS安全性進行排查。

控制台操作日誌。記錄所有在控制台上進行的修改類操作,便於管理員查看並管理RDS。

雲MySQL和雲伺服器上裝MySQL的區別

雲資料庫是指被優化或部署到一個虛擬計算環境中的資料庫,可以實現按需付費、按需擴展、高可用性以及存儲整合等優勢。

企業伴隨著業務的增長,成倍增長的數據需要更多的存儲空間,此時,雲資料庫有助於應對許多這些資料庫方面的挑戰。

讓用戶能夠在雲中輕鬆設置、操作和擴展關係資料庫,並可以充分結合公有雲中的計算、網路與存儲服務,從而以一種安全、可擴展、可靠的方式,迅速選擇、配置和運行數據管理基礎設施,使用戶能專註於自身應用程序和業務。

RDS是關係型資料庫(Relational Database Service),一種基於雲計算的可即開即用、穩定可靠、彈性伸縮、便捷管理的在線關係型雲資料庫服  務。

雖然客戶可以在雲服 務器上自建MySQL,而其也會帶有部分雲特性:數據高可靠性保障、彈性擴展、基礎運維等。但與在雲服 務器自建資料庫相比,RDS為單位提供更多的自動化服 務,如:資料庫自動備份、IP白名單、詳細的實時監控、容災、讀寫分離等,還避免了雲服 務器帶來的異常,如雲服 務器CPU偶爾會被mysql進程拉到100%。

華雲數據RDS提供了容災、備份、恢復、監控、遷移等方面的全套解決方案,支持將本地資料庫遷移到RDS,平滑完成資料庫的遷移工作,徹底解決資料庫運維的煩惱。

原創文章,作者:小藍,如若轉載,請註明出處:https://www.506064.com/zh-tw/n/297530.html

(0)
打賞 微信掃一掃 微信掃一掃 支付寶掃一掃 支付寶掃一掃
小藍的頭像小藍
上一篇 2024-12-28 12:16
下一篇 2024-12-28 12:16

相關推薦

  • 如何修改mysql的埠號

    本文將介紹如何修改mysql的埠號,方便開發者根據實際需求配置對應埠號。 一、為什麼需要修改mysql埠號 默認情況下,mysql使用的埠號是3306。在某些情況下,我們需…

    編程 2025-04-29
  • Python 常用資料庫有哪些?

    在Python編程中,資料庫是不可或缺的一部分。隨著互聯網應用的不斷擴大,處理海量數據已成為一種趨勢。Python有許多成熟的資料庫管理系統,接下來我們將從多個方面介紹Python…

    編程 2025-04-29
  • openeuler安裝資料庫方案

    本文將介紹在openeuler操作系統中安裝資料庫的方案,並提供代碼示例。 一、安裝MariaDB 下面介紹如何在openeuler中安裝MariaDB。 1、更新軟體源 sudo…

    編程 2025-04-29
  • 伺服器安裝Python的完整指南

    本文將為您提供伺服器安裝Python的完整指南。無論您是一位新手還是經驗豐富的開發者,您都可以通過本文輕鬆地完成Python的安裝過程。以下是本文的具體內容: 一、下載Python…

    編程 2025-04-29
  • STUN 伺服器

    STUN 伺服器是一個網路伺服器,可以協助網路設備(例如 VoIP 設備)解決 NAT 穿透、防火牆等問題,使得設備可以正常地進行數據傳輸。本文將從多個方面對 STUN 伺服器做詳…

    編程 2025-04-29
  • Python操作MySQL

    本文將從以下幾個方面對Python操作MySQL進行詳細闡述: 一、連接MySQL資料庫 在使用Python操作MySQL之前,我們需要先連接MySQL資料庫。在Python中,我…

    編程 2025-04-29
  • 解決docker-compose 容器時間和伺服器時間不同步問題

    docker-compose是一種工具,能夠讓您使用YAML文件來定義和運行多個容器。然而,有時候容器的時間與伺服器時間不同步,導致一些不必要的錯誤和麻煩。以下是解決方法的詳細介紹…

    編程 2025-04-29
  • 資料庫第三範式會有刪除插入異常

    如果沒有正確設計資料庫,第三範式可能導致刪除和插入異常。以下是詳細解釋: 一、什麼是第三範式和範式理論? 範式理論是關係資料庫中的一個規範化過程。第三範式是範式理論中的一種常見形式…

    編程 2025-04-29
  • MySQL遞歸函數的用法

    本文將從多個方面對MySQL遞歸函數的用法做詳細的闡述,包括函數的定義、使用方法、示例及注意事項。 一、遞歸函數的定義 遞歸函數是指在函數內部調用自身的函數。MySQL提供了CRE…

    編程 2025-04-29
  • leveldb和unqlite:兩個高性能的資料庫存儲引擎

    本文將介紹兩款高性能的資料庫存儲引擎:leveldb和unqlite,並從多個方面對它們進行詳細的闡述。 一、leveldb:輕量級的鍵值存儲引擎 1、leveldb概述: lev…

    編程 2025-04-28

發表回復

登錄後才能評論